  • This dress is India a classic A-line in style light weight enough for over seas and you could wear an underskirt underneath this if you wanted too. Although it is made to be worn without. Now this dress generally comes with an unlined bodice so it’s got those see through cup details, but I have had my bodice lined it’s always an option with a lot of our dresses. It’s got this really low dipped V at the front here, this ofcourse can be filled in. With some extra bead work or if you got the dress a little bit big you could even pull that together and make it a solid seam as well. You’ve got an off the shoulder detail here which is these really beautiful sleeves now that is detachable and I’m going to show you how that comes round at the back. It actually turns into a suggestion of a cape. It’s not fitting my mannequin so I have had to just pin it around roughly. That cape detailing does fasten as a jacket style at the back with three or four buttons and you can take that off for later on in the evening. But as you can see it puts this really beautiful extra detail it’s sort of a cross between a cape and sleeves because it is two spate pieces there and the detail on it is quite beautiful. You’ve got all these flowers coming down and some really nice lace work on that too. You can of course take that of for later on and give yourself that shorter train to cope with, that of course will hook up. You could shorten that and go floor length or tea length if you wanted too. I wouldn’t put any extra detail on this dress it’s busy enough just as it is. But as I said don’t forget these little sleeves do come off, you could ofcourse add some straps to this dress if you wanted too. So if I just drop those sleeves there you can see how this dress would look strapless too, for later on in the evening. Straps ofcourse could be added if you wanted that little bit of extra security.
